Where to eat in Budapest – what to try

Budapest is a destination within reach for Romanians due to its proximity, but also a true culinary paradise that will surprise you at every step. The city delights you with a varied cuisine, full of influences from different cultures, making every meal a special experience.
From sophisticated Michelin-starred Michelin-starred restaurants to neighborhood eateries and street stalls serving authentic dishes full of flavor, Budapest has something for every taste. Imagine exploring a cosmopolitan city with impressive architecture while savoring the most delicious cuisine. And the best part? If you’re wondering where to eat in Budapest, we’re on hand to recommend the best places for an unforgettable experience.
- Where to eat in Budapest – traditional dishes and where to find them
- Restaurants Budapest – where to eat
Where to eat in Budapest – traditional dishes and where to find them
In the following, we will introduce you to some of the most popular traditional Hungarian dishes and where to eat them in Budapest.
Goulash
What could be better after a stroll through the Old Center of Budapest than a steaming bowl of delicious goulash? This world-famous dish is more than just beef soup and often takes on the consistency of a savory stew, where the intense flavor of the meat blends perfectly with the taste of fresh vegetables and sweet paprika.
Every place in Budapest offers its own interpretation of the recipe, but if you want to enjoy an authentic traditional version, we recommend restaurants like Szaletly, Bestia or Fakanál. All are conveniently located in the central area, close to the most important museums, so you’ll be able to perfectly combine cultural exploration with culinary delights.
Lángos
A stay in Budapest wouldn’t be complete without savoring their famous traditional pie, lángos. Although seemingly simple, this street delicacy will win you over with its fluffy texture and unique flavor combinations. Made from a leavened dough and fried until golden brown, lángos is served with a variety of toppings that make it irresistible.
The most popular version is savory, with a generous layer of grated cheese and creamy sour cream, often topped with a dash of garlic sauce for added flavor. For those with a sweet tooth, you’ll also find mouth-watering versions with jam or chocolate cream that turn this snack into the perfect dessert.
If you want to try an authentic lángos, visit Zrny and Langosom.
Kürtőskalács
Kürtőskalács is the dessert that conquers everyone. With its soft, pastry-like dough, this delicacy is distinguished by its unique cylindrical shape and traditional preparation process, which gives it an unmistakable taste and texture.
After being baked on the hearth or in the jar, the kürtőskalács is generously dusted with sugar and cinnamon, the flavor is simply irresistible. But the variety doesn’t stop there – you can find modern versions with chocolate, walnut, coconut glazes or even filled with ice cream, perfect for warmer days.
This dessert is freshly made at numerous kiosks in the city, where you can enjoy the spectacle of baking and the flavor of a freshly baked kürtőskalács. If you want an authentic experience, we recommend exploring the Central Market area, where you’ll find the best versions of this iconic dessert, and Molnár’s Kürtőskalács, one of the most popular places to eat this traditional dessert in Budapest.
Dobos cake
This exquisite dessert, a symbol of Hungarian culinary art, is a must in cafes and bakeries all over the country and a favorite choice for anniversaries, weddings and special occasions. The Dobos cake impresses with 7 perfectly balanced layers of fluffy pastry, each topped with a chocolate cream and caramelized nuts. The pièce de résistance is the caramel-frosted top layer, which offers an irresistible contrast of textures.
The dessert is said to have been created by famous pastry chef Jozsef C. Dobos and was first served in 1885 in Budapest in honor of King Franz Joseph I and Queen Elisabeth.
If you want to experience this dessert in a place with tradition, we recommend a visit to the famous Café Gerbeaud, where the original recipe and elegant atmosphere will give you a real insight into the history and culture of Budapest.
Halászlé
A truly iconic dish in Hungarian cuisine is halászlé, the famous fish soup. Surprising as it may seem, fish is not a popular choice on the everyday Hungarian menu. However, this soup is considered a festive delicacy, carefully prepared on special occasions such as Christmas or other national holidays.
Being a landlocked country, the fish come from rivers and lakes, which is why the main ingredient is carp. Halászlé is distinguished by its intense flavor, which is achieved thanks to the generous addition of sweet and spicy paprika, an emblematic spice of Hungarian cuisine.
One restaurant in Budapest serving this dish is Bagolyvár.
Chicken paprikash
Chicken paprikash is one of the most emblematic dishes of Hungarian gastronomy. This dish highlights the basic ingredient of Hungarian cuisine – paprika – which gives the dish both its intense color and unmistakable flavor.
Paprikash is often served with fluffy flour dumplings (nokedli), which perfectly complement the creamy texture of the sauce. For an authentic experience, we recommend trying it in Budapest’s restaurants: Regős Vendéglő, Barack & Szilva, or Magyar QTR.
Nokedli – “Hungarian “Gnocchi
Nokedli, often called Hungarian gnocchi, are a traditional side dish not to be missed in Hungarian meals. Although not a main dish, these small dumplings made from simple dough are versatile and complement dishes with rich sauces.
If you want to try them, you’ll find them served as a side dish in traditional Budapest restaurants such as Regős Vendéglő or Barack & Szilva.
Hortobágyi Palacsinta
Hortobágyi Palacsinta is an authentic Hungarian dish that turns simple pancakes into a culinary feast. They are stuffed with a savory mixture of minced meat, well seasoned with typical Hungarian flavors such as sweet paprika. After being carefully rolled, the pancakes are baked in the oven and served topped with a generous layer of creamy cream sauce.
This dish is a popular choice in Budapest restaurants and is recommended by locals and tourists alike.
Pörkölt
Pörkölt is another traditional Hungarian dish, a rich and flavorful stew. Made from pork or beef, it is slow-cooked with fresh vegetables in a savory onion and tomato sauce.
This hearty stew is often served with fluffy dumplings (nokedli), which perfectly complement the texture and rich flavor of the dish.
👉 Plan a long weekend in Budapest, where tons of unmissable activities await you! To explore the city hassle-free, we suggest renting a car. This way, you will quickly and comfortably reach all the attractions on your itinerary.
Restaurants Budapest – where to eat
If we’ve introduced you to the most popular Hungarian dishes, now we’ll give you a list of restaurants where to eat in Budapest:
Klauzal Restaurant – culinary tradition and diversity
If you’re in the center of Budapest and looking for a tasty meal, Klauzal Restaurant is an excellent choice. It combines traditional Hungarian dishes with international recipes, offering a diverse menu to suit all tastes. The warm atmosphere and central location make it the perfect place to eat in Budapest during a break while exploring the city.
Karavan – street food
If you like street food, Karavan is the place to be in Budapest. This space is home to a variety of food trucks, each with dishes that will delight your taste buds. From juicy burgers and Hungarian pizza, to tacos, cocktails and the famous kürtőskalács, Karavan has something for everyone. The atmosphere is relaxed, perfect for a cozy evening meal.
Gerbeaud Café – elegance with the scent of history
A visit to the Gerbeaud Café is like traveling back in time. Open since the 1900s, this iconic café impresses with its rococo decor, high ceilings and sophisticated atmosphere.
It’s the ideal place to savor exquisite cakes, though the prices match the elegance. Recommendations include traditional desserts and the location itself is a unique experience. To avoid the crowds, plan an off-peak visit.
Kiosk Budapest
Another place to eat in Budapest is Kiosk Budapest. With a contemporary design and a relaxed atmosphere, this restaurant-cocktail bar is the ideal place for a business lunch or an evening out with friends. The menu includes delights such as mini burgers, truffle risotto, steaks and homemade ice cream desserts, all prepared with attention to detail.
Las Vegans – an explosion of vegan flavors
Las Vegans will win you over with its creative and delicious dishes. The location is full of charm, decorated with cheerful animal drawings that bring the place to life. Be sure to try their unusual lemonade, flavored with chili peppers and cucumber for a unique mix of flavors.
So there are many traditional restaurants to eat out in Budapest, and each of them offers an authentic take on Hungarian cuisine. As well as classics, you’ll also find modern restaurants reinventing traditional cuisine with a contemporary twist. Whatever your preference, Budapest manages to blend tradition with modernity, giving you an unforgettable dining experience. If you need more inspiration, you can also find us on Facebook, Instagram or LinkedIn.
Surse foto: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ock, Shutterstock